)]}'
{
  "log": [
    {
      "commit": "098c7a3d157218dab4eed595e8f2fbe5a20a0bae",
      "tree": "1daaf705713227da3f8740bc6f561a8379273fbb",
      "parents": [
        "e83f154a8bab4d8b8d6846f3f5b5e094fac61084"
      ],
      "author": {
        "name": "Jack Hou",
        "email": "jackhou@chromium.org",
        "time": "Tue Oct 14 00:28:06 2014"
      },
      "committer": {
        "name": "Jack Hou",
        "email": "jackhou@chromium.org",
        "time": "Tue Oct 14 02:44:34 2014"
      },
      "message": "Update base/extractor.[cc|h] for security review.\n\nChange-Id: I58430f3609301ec6b07610917345c958c67cc26a\nReviewed-on: https://chromium-review.googlesource.com/223041\nReviewed-by: Will Harris \u003cwfh@chromium.org\u003e\nReviewed-by: Jack Hou \u003cjackhou@chromium.org\u003e\nTested-by: Jack Hou \u003cjackhou@chromium.org\u003e\n"
    },
    {
      "commit": "e83f154a8bab4d8b8d6846f3f5b5e094fac61084",
      "tree": "d6cc5fb87a8cf6329ff61cb53dce6071d6071b55",
      "parents": [
        "e2c3f15816f1a394e56433de4fb58db30548fdb0"
      ],
      "author": {
        "name": "Jack Hou",
        "email": "jackhou@chromium.org",
        "time": "Fri Oct 03 07:27:31 2014"
      },
      "committer": {
        "name": "Jack Hou",
        "email": "jackhou@chromium.org",
        "time": "Mon Oct 13 02:20:51 2014"
      },
      "message": "Keep only base/extractor.[cc|h].\n\nChange-Id: I2fd15eeae9fcba3f33d10317bba92634959860d8\nReviewed-on: https://chromium-review.googlesource.com/220982\nReviewed-by: Jack Hou \u003cjackhou@chromium.org\u003e\nCommit-Queue: Jack Hou \u003cjackhou@chromium.org\u003e\nTested-by: Jack Hou \u003cjackhou@chromium.org\u003e\nReviewed-by: Ben Wells \u003cbenwells@chromium.org\u003e\nCommit-Queue: Ben Wells \u003cbenwells@chromium.org\u003e\n"
    },
    {
      "commit": "e2c3f15816f1a394e56433de4fb58db30548fdb0",
      "tree": "96909457b781399450a1332c3593828da01dc0be",
      "parents": [
        "d2824a2f5d1d4d4d6cc6337bda20d78ffaec7ca1"
      ],
      "author": {
        "name": "ryanmyers@google.com",
        "email": "ryanmyers@google.com",
        "time": "Wed Aug 17 01:24:39 2011"
      },
      "committer": {
        "name": "ryanmyers@google.com",
        "email": "ryanmyers@google.com",
        "time": "Wed Aug 17 01:24:39 2011"
      },
      "message": "Fix MIME type on ADM files and reupload.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@110 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"d2824a2f5d1d4d4d6cc6337bda20d78ffaec7ca1",
      "tree": "96909457b781399450a1332c3593828da01dc0be",
      "parents": [
        "8328814108609a7061697caea3f48bca98c2938f"
      ],
      "author": {
        "name": "ryanmyers@google.com",
        "email": "ryanmyers@google.com",
        "time": "Wed Aug 17 01:07:48 2011"
      },
      "committer": {
        "name": "ryanmyers@google.com",
        "email": "ryanmyers@google.com",
        "time": "Wed Aug 17 01:07:48 2011"
      },
      "message": "Commit to version 1.3.23.0 (67)\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@109 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"8328814108609a7061697caea3f48bca98c2938f",
      "tree": "6aae71986839b1fb90daf1c46b848792af34d829",
      "parents": [
        "fd9bd1cfe83b2aa222cc2cba8ff03c45f7a9f1e2"
      ],
      "author":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Wed Jun 09 23:09:48 2010"
      },
      "committer":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Wed Jun 09 23:09:48 2010"
      },
      "message": "Includes a few bug fixes. Also introduces omaha_version_utils.py, which now contains the supported languages and required files.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@105 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"fd9bd1cfe83b2aa222cc2cba8ff03c45f7a9f1e2",
      "tree": "5a5434736b7107ab34f22fafd634f19cc8758aca",
      "parents": [
        "94f6df86823283084a270f9eb62307907c3a1043"
      ],
      "author":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Thu Mar 18 21:36:29 2010"
      },
      "committer":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Thu Mar 18 21:36:29 2010"
      },
      "message": "Removed obsolete files.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@104 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"94f6df86823283084a270f9eb62307907c3a1043",
      "tree": "d29bd88b0e273caed8007de02febbff05de8a9cb",
      "parents": [
        "d3a3fcd2e3141534c2564c53309892f3f73afaa9"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Thu Mar 18 20:55:06 2010"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Thu Mar 18 20:55:06 2010"
      },
      "message": "\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@103 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"d3a3fcd2e3141534c2564c53309892f3f73afaa9",
      "tree": "c33628631db91c11f68297e19e70b9ace3c4f4d4",
      "parents": [
        "17023a97fb2632e4d4f109616a7efa2cb946bb72"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Thu Mar 18 18:53:57 2010"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Thu Mar 18 18:53:57 2010"
      },
      "message": "\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@102 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"17023a97fb2632e4d4f109616a7efa2cb946bb72",
      "tree": "fd85b777b6a3dedd5c76839246af7bea4689ae68",
      "parents": [
        "792c57f8c186ad38a74b94a06957a7b7d925f0f7"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Thu Mar 18 02:24:35 2010"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Thu Mar 18 02:24:35 2010"
      },
      "message": "Commit to version 1.2.187.0 (23)\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@101 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"792c57f8c186ad38a74b94a06957a7b7d925f0f7",
      "tree": "993046c503cba48b66425ee30391a677f64782a3",
      "parents": [
        "7274410f62ef28144a49ac54e315f037f5e01b96"
      ],
      "author":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Mon Sep 21 21:13:29 2009"
      },
      "committer":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Mon Sep 21 21:13:29 2009"
      },
      "message": "Update the timestamped test file.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@79 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"7274410f62ef28144a49ac54e315f037f5e01b96",
      "tree": "194c90fad6a2308c21f4db83335836dd592613c5",
      "parents": [
        "632bc153ea102bceb60fa4df066734f49df3ea10"
      ],
      "author":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Tue Jul 07 21:11:36 2009"
      },
      "committer":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Tue Jul 07 21:11:36 2009"
      },
      "message": "Set the svn:eol-style property for all files to \"native\". The only exception is enterprise\\test_gold.adm, which is set to CRLF as required by Group Policy Editor.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@66 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"632bc153ea102bceb60fa4df066734f49df3ea10",
      "tree": "5abc4f709faa7dc9dfb0f1a74d36c0d21485f3da",
      "parents": [
        "24e8f996509820d8e35252775ac363e4162df588"
      ],
      "author": {
        "name": "ganesh@google.com",
        "email": "ganesh@google.com",
        "time": "Fri Jul 03 00:04:35 2009"
      },
      "committer": {
        "name": "ganesh@google.com",
        "email": "ganesh@google.com",
        "time": "Fri Jul 03 00:04:35 2009"
      },
      "message": "\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@58 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"24e8f996509820d8e35252775ac363e4162df588",
      "tree": "9f20ace64672e8b8f66f9dcff737de2cd88dfe64",
      "parents": [
        "bc21a507247ef70d71eb107b3e1a271a01c832e5"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Fri May 15 23:19:53 2009"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Fri May 15 23:19:53 2009"
      },
      "message": "Fix a build break when --mode\u003dall is used plus small other fixes.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@57 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"bc21a507247ef70d71eb107b3e1a271a01c832e5",
      "tree": "e5816b847fb77931acf2eae14765e6828197d14f",
      "parents": [
        "3ce5afd1c7f8766afc241c71045558fd8b7b15dd"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Fri May 15 22:37:52 2009"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Fri May 15 22:37:52 2009"
      },
      "message": "The bin files are not needed for the build. They make the checkout larger needlessly.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@56 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"3ce5afd1c7f8766afc241c71045558fd8b7b15dd",
      "tree": "b11c6182a2018559e43c9a7bf63713f010e47a1d",
      "parents": [
        "75e7a83d4d8485a62c4b3ffe52f57d9d5b59c33e"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Fri May 15 00:01:52 2009"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Fri May 15 00:01:52 2009"
      },
      "message": "\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@54 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"75e7a83d4d8485a62c4b3ffe52f57d9d5b59c33e",
      "tree": "c9549c4a9904b0c3a8177cf34e99afaf733e810b",
      "parents": [
        "0ed19b0ba9dc1938eb5b1280d7004574408e573e"
      ],
      "author":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Mon Apr 20 22:07:00 2009"
      },
      "committer": {
        "name": "sorin@google.com",
        "email": "sorin@google.com",
        "time": "Mon Apr 20 22:07:00 2009"
      },
      "message": "Many smaller fixes and support for building with \nVisual Studio 2009/VC90.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@51 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"0ed19b0ba9dc1938eb5b1280d7004574408e573e",
      "tree": "67708a3002d4287f98d4c5a86ff625b9c873eb41",
      "parents": [
        "7f8644fd379eea4a87830e9dcfcbfdc6c1740a0f"
      ],
      "author":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Fri Apr 10 22:02:06 2009"
      },
      "committer":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Fri Apr 10 22:02:06 2009"
      },
      "message": "Fixed unit tests that fail when run in different environments.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@41 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"7f8644fd379eea4a87830e9dcfcbfdc6c1740a0f",
      "tree": "a78be11126285ab4eca53927750c6ae9377cc3d3",
      "parents": [
        "06f816ccb62260f49d998f27d8ed971e20c52e99"
      ],
      "author":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Fri Apr 10 18:47:43 2009"
      },
      "committer": {
        "name": "ddorwin@google.com",
        "email": "ddorwin@google.com",
        "time": "Fri Apr 10 18:47:43 2009"
      },
      "message": "Disable coverage builds for now.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@35 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"06f816ccb62260f49d998f27d8ed971e20c52e99",
      "tree": "91a281e021d26ae43bad562ba027754a8fff4645",
      "parents": [
        "df29f0f3a3db5ef213b6bec7fa7c102bff947ab7"
      ],
      "author":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Fri Apr 10 06:24:06 2009"
      },
      "committer":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Fri Apr 10 06:24:06 2009"
      },
      "message": "Sync to 10774716\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@31 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"df29f0f3a3db5ef213b6bec7fa7c102bff947ab7",
      "tree": "bf24bb2883d555ee99f8bd1d39ca419bd9406202",
      "parents": [
        "144952713223d135a5084b01ac0bde82b2c8d462"
      ],
      "author":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Fri Apr 10 02:01:04 2009"
      },
      "committer":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Fri Apr 10 02:01:04 2009"
      },
      "message": "Ensure Vista SDK is used as much as possible for builds.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@28 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"144952713223d135a5084b01ac0bde82b2c8d462",
      "tree": "8a722a7980a6dfedc06801f2f2245013219310ff",
      "parents": [
        "80ca7b19adb6522b66738c019452321ff8fee389"
      ],
      "author":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Thu Apr 09 00:43:23 2009"
      },
      "committer":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Thu Apr 09 00:43:23 2009"
      },
      "message": "Couple of last minute fixes.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@20 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"80ca7b19adb6522b66738c019452321ff8fee389",
      "tree": "86b352aa94e949a339aa69db655d3fb2952b6d12",
      "parents": [
        "a3bd390dc8e24e60e283fa15ee553529449e32b7"
      ],
      "author":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Thu Apr 09 00:14:40 2009"
      },
      "committer": {
        "name": "mylesj@google.com",
        "email": "mylesj@google.com",
        "time": "Thu Apr 09 00:14:40 2009"
      },
      "message": "Initial import.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@19 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    },
    {
      "commit": "a3bd390dc8e24e60e283fa15ee553529449e32b7",
      "tree": "4b825dc642cb6eb9a060e54bf8d69288fbee4904",
      "parents": [],
      "author": {
        "name": "(no author)",
        "email": "(no author)",
        "time": "Tue Feb 24 20:51:27 2009"
      },
      "committer": {
        "name": "(no author)",
        "email": "(no author)",
        "time": "Tue Feb 24 20:51:27 2009"
      },
      "message": "Initial directory structure.\n\ngit-svn-id: http://omaha.googlecode.com/svn/trunk@1 e782f428-02b4-11de-a43f-ff96a2b7a9af\n"
    }
  ]
}
